major efficiency necessities for photo voltaic Cleaning robotic Batteries

Solar cleansing robots need a battery Answer that delivers steady performance and durability. large-capability Lithium Batteries are essential to be certain extended operational time, permitting the robotic to scrub a bigger floor spot on an individual demand. excess weight is additionally a significant component, as lighter batteries Enhance the robotic’s maneuverability and lessen put on and tear to the cleaning mechanism. On top of that, these batteries need to face up to harsh environmental ailments, which includes Excessive temperatures, dust, and moisture. rapidly charging capabilities may also be important to limit downtime and improve efficiency. a strong Battery Management technique (BMS) is necessary to stop overcharging, deep discharging, and overheating, guaranteeing the security and longevity of the battery.

evaluating Lithium Battery Technologies for Automated Solar upkeep

numerous lithium battery systems can be found, Each and every with its own pros and cons. Lithium Iron Phosphate (LiFePO4) batteries are known for their superb protection, lengthy lifespan, and thermal security, generating them perfect for demanding purposes like solar cleaning robots. Lithium-ion (Li-ion) batteries present superior Power density but may possibly involve much more sophisticated thermal administration methods. Lithium Polymer (LiPo) batteries are lightweight and will be molded into many shapes, but They are really generally much less resilient and also have a shorter lifespan than LiFePO4 batteries. When deciding on a battery technology, consider the precise operating circumstances, performance necessities, and safety criteria within your photo voltaic cleaning robotic. LiFePO4 often emerges as the popular selection resulting from its equilibrium of functionality, security, and longevity.
